Abstract

Abstract The optical properties of mechanochromic materials change under mechanical stress. Segmented polyurethanes are elastomers composed of amorphous, saturated chain soft segments, and rigid pi-conjugated hard domains. Within aggregates of hard domains pi– pi interactions may form and result in perturbation of the optoelectronic properties of the system.
